It's that time of the year! Yuletide is starting to stir, NaNoWriMo is just around the corner, and a lot of fannish people start looking at their calendars and count the days until Christmas, and the Christmas fic exchanges.

So far, we haven't done one. But we've got our share of artists and writers, and a truly talented bunch it is! So I would like to propose a Coldfire fic exchange for Christmas. But this, of course, is only going to work if we get participants. (And before anyone wonders, we've cleared this with the Yuletide mods - no point in getting Coldfire banned from there!)

The idea is to keep this as simple as possible, and open to as many people as possible, writers or not. Of course writers are encouraged (where would the fics come from, otherwise?) but if you honestly don't feel you can write, then you aren't excluded.

How is it going to work? Like this:

  • Everyone offering to write or draw something is guaranteed to get a request fulfilled.

  • Everyone who isn't up to writing or drawing can submit requests which may or may not get picked up. We'll try our best to arrange something for everyone so something can be found in every stocking in the end.


We're not going to impose minimum word counts or any other qualifiers. A little scene, a sketch - the idea is to have more fic and art again, not to make anyone worry about word counts on top of all the other Christmas time challenges out there. If you can offer a drabble or two, that is enough. If you manage a ficlet, that's even better. A fic or a full drawing, and we'll love you forever.

There won't be assignments either - those who offer to write will get to look at the requests from the full list (anonymized, of course) so they can say which ones they would be willing to write. They'll be asked to write one of them to make sure authors are covered. The other requests will be collected too and your friendly neighbourhood mods will do their best to arrange for someone to pick them up and fill them. Since this is a fairly small fandom and we expect participants not to join by the thousands (though we'd love it!), a free selection of requests and prompts should be possible.

The provisorical timeline is to get requests in over the next two weeks or thereabouts, then quickly figure out who wants which request so everybody has maximum writing time.

Please comment if you are interested in this, and tell us whether you might be able to write or draw. Also tell us if you can't, but whether you want to make requests (don't tell us what, though!). This isn't a firm signup, it's just to give us a general idea whether it's going to be two or ten people who'll play. If you change your mind later, that's perfectly fine.
